DescriptionDistributed and scalable native Graph DBMSAn embeddable, in-process, column-oriented SQL OLAP RDBMSFileMaker is a cross-platform RDBMS that includes a GUI frontend.mSQL (Mini SQL) is a simple and lightweight RDBMSOpen-Source SQL RDBMS for Operational and Analytical use cases with native Machine Learning, powered by Hadoop and Spark
Primary database modelGraph DBMSRelational DBMSRelational DBMSRelational DBMSRelational DBMS
